Abstract

Aim of the work
This work aims to study the diagnostic and prognostic value of some autoantibodies; anti-CCP, and biochemical markers; HA and COMP, hs-CRP in OA patients and their relation to disease progression.
Conclusions
We can conclude that:
♦ The measurements of serum HA and COMP may be of diagnostic and prognostic value in differentiating patients with joint destruction and in determining disease progression.
♦ A single biochemical marker has definitive diagnostic value and the combination with other biochemical markers as well as with clinical and radiographic data would most likely help to improve the clinical assessment of patients affected with this common disorder.
♦ Serum HA and anti-CCP were the most specific markers with the highest positive predictive value.
♦ There was evidence of autoimmunity with OA and it was associated with presence of synovitis but not related to the degree of joint destruction.
♦ Clinical indices, NRSP and WOMAC are poorly related to the joint destruction or laboratory markers.
♦ Using the compartmental evaluation of Thomas score with biochemical markers is better than K-L grading system especially with short durations of follow up.
